Normally to control another computer we often use TeamViewer software, because this is a popular remote control software and is popular with many users. However, if you are in the same LAN, you do not need to use those 3rd party software, but you can use a feature available in Windows called Remote Desktop. Remote Desktop tool will help us control computers on the same LAN easily without installing any other applications. The following article TipsMake.com will guide you how to enable and use the Remote Desktop feature on Windows 10 to control the computer. Please follow along.

Step 1: To use the Remote Desktop feature you must first enable it by the following way.

You open Settings in windows 10 then select System.

Picture 2 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 2 : In the new window, select the Remote Desktop item in the left column, then on the right side of the window, find the Enable Remote Desktop item and switch from Off to On to enable Remote Desktop. If a message appears, click the Confirm button .

Note: You must enable Remote Desktop both on your computer and the controlled machine.

Picture 3 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 3: So we have activated Remote Desktop, now to be able to control another computer you need to know the IP address of that computer.

To see the IP address you do the following:

First press the Windows + R key combination to open the Run dialog box, enter the command ncpa.cpl and press Enter

Picture 4 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

A new window appears, right-click on the connected network and select Status

Picture 5 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

A small window appears, click the Details button .

Picture 6 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

In the new window you can see the IP address of that computer in the Ipv4 Address section

Picture 7 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 4: Once you have the IP address, go back to your computer and open the Remote Desktop Connection tool by opening the search and find the tool as shown below.

Picture 8 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 5 : At the interface of the Remote Desktop tool, enter the IP address of the controlled machine in the box and click Connect

Picture 9 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 6: In the new window, enter the username and password of the computer to be controlled and click OK.

To know your username, you can right-click on the This PC icon and select Properties , then in the new window you look at the Computer name section which is the computer's login name.

Picture 10 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

If a message appears, click Yes

Picture 11 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Then you wait for the computer to connect with each other and we will be taken to the screen of the other computer to control.

In addition to using the available Remote Desktop Connection tool, you can use Microsoft Remote Desktop software developed by Microsoft for Windows 10. This software has a nicer interface and when connecting you do not need an IP address.

Step 1 : To download the software, you must access the Microsoft Store application store and find Microsoft Remote Desktop application as shown below and click Install to install.

Or you can go to this link to quickly open the app store:

https://www.microsoft.com/store/productId/9WZDNCRFJ3PS

Picture 13 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 2 : After the installation is complete, open the application, click the Add button, and then select the Desktop item

Picture 14 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 3 : Enter the name of the computer and click Save .

Picture 15 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 4: We will see a new computer appear on the software, click on that computer.

Picture 16 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Step 5: Enter the username and password of the computer to be controlled and click Connect

Picture 17 of How to control a computer in LAN with Remote Desktop is available in Windows 10

Then a new window will appear, click Connect again and we will be taken to the screen of the computer to be controlled.
